(Minghui.org) Three families in Linghai City, Liaoning Province, are in no mood to celebrate the upcoming 2022 Chinese New Year on February 1, as their loved ones remain detained for practicing Falun Gong, a spiritual discipline that has been persecuted by the Chinese communist regime since 1999. 

One woman’s husband became severely depressed because of her arrest. Another woman’s 85-year-old mother-in-law fell ill and often asked for her whereabouts. The third woman’s husband, in his 70s with very poor vision, struggles to live on his own.

Ms. Chen Yujie

Ms. Chen Yujie happened to witness the police arresting another practitioner, Ms. Wei Xiuying, while walking on the street on May 25, 2021. She tried to stop the police, only to be arrested herself. 

The police proceeded to raid Ms. Chen’s home, terrifying her husband, who is not a practitioner. He was dealt another heavy blow when she was secretly sentenced to five years by the Linghai City Court in late November 2021, after he spent months trying to rescue her. The six-foot-tall man developed severe depression. He became bedridden and unable to care for himself. He constantly has thoughts of suicide. At the time of writing, he lives with his sister, as his own daughter struggles to care for her child.

Ms. Yan Lijun

Ms. Yan Lijun, 59, was arrested at home on the evening of June 3, 2021. She had just broken her arm two days prior and was still wearing the plaster cast when the police took her away. Her husband, who doesn’t practice Falun Gong, tried to stop the police. They refused to listen and ordered him to verbally abuse Falun Gong’s founder. As he didn’t cooperate with the police, they accused him of interfering with law enforcement and arrested him as well, leaving his 85-year-old mother at home by herself. 

Ms. Yan has been held at the Jinzhou City Women’s Detention Center since and her husband was released after 15 days of administrative detention. 

Ms. Yan’s arrest devastated her mother-in-law, who relies on her for care. She quickly fell ill and often asked her son, “What law has Lijun violated? When will she come back?” Her son was unable to answer. He also struggles with declining health due to the mental pressure. 

Ms. Yan’s husband said that the detention center has asked him to deposit 1,000 yuan each month in the first three months after she was arrested. Now they have stopped asking for the deposit, but the guards refused to provide any update about her situation. He inquired about her case at the Linghai City Procuratorate, which claimed that they didn’t have her case on file. 

Ms. Xu Suqing

Ms. Xu Suqing, 71, was arrested at home on July 27, 2021, by four plainclothes officers. They searched her home, including her storage room, and confiscated many of her personal items. She and her husband, who doesn’t practice Falun Gong, were both taken to the police station. While her husband was released in the evening, she was taken to the Jinzhou City Women’s Detention Center. 

Ms. Xu was tried by the Linghai City Court through a video conference on November 19, 2021. Her family wasn’t allowed to attend the session. It’s reported that she has been sentenced to 1.5 years. 

Ms. Xu’s husband is 77 and has very poor vision. He struggles to care for himself following her arrest and has moved back to his hometown in the countryside.
